Class of 1828
|
Vol. I |
(Born D. C.) |
Thomas Cutts |
(Ap'd Me.) |
|
|
Military History. — Cadet at the Military Academy, July 1, 1824, to July 1, 1828, when he was graduated and promoted in the Army to Bvt. Second Lieut. of Infantry, July 1, 1828. Second Lieut., 3d Infantry, July 1, 1828. Served: on frontier duty at Jefferson Barracks, Mo., 1828, — Ft. Leavenworth, Kan., 1829, — Jefferson Barracks, Mo., 1829‑30, — on Red River, about Natchitoches,º La., 1830‑31, — Ft. Towson, I. T., 1831‑32, — and Ft. Jesup, La., 1832‑35; on Recruiting service, 1835‑36; as Adjutant, 3d Infantry, at Regimental headquarters, Nov. 28, 1836, to (First Lieut., 3d Infantry, June 15, 1836) May 31, 1838; and on frontier duty at Ft. Jesup, La., 1836‑38. Died Sep. 2, 1838, at Ft. Jesup, La.: Aged 31. |
